우산잔디족(雨傘--族, 학명: Cynodonteae 키노돈테아이[*])은 나도바랭이아과이다.[1] 800종 이상을 포함하고 있다.[2][3][4][5] 나도바랭이아과에 속하는 다른 식물들처럼, 우산잔디족 종들도 온난, 건조 기후 지역에 적응해 진화했다. 모두 C4 광합성 식물이다.
